  • What is a Fractional Factorial Design? A fractional factorial design is a type of experimental design used to analyse the effects of several factors (or variables) on a response variable. What is the difference with a full factorial design? In a full factorial design, every possible combination of factor levels is examined. Conversely, a fractional factorial design strategically excludes certain combinations. This reduce the number of experiments while still capturing essential information about the system's behavior.
